We are having an activity based Youth Day for kids on August 27th from 9 am to 2 pm at Beaverbrook in East Bethel. It is totally free and the kids can shoot shotgun, .22s, pellet guns, archery, try orienteering, follow a blood trail, go through a shoot/dont shoot course and lotsa other stuff. We REALLY want to get kids out there whom have not had a chance to experience some of these things, so if you know of a kid who may have an interest but doesnt have the opportunity, please share this with them and lets get them involved. Lunch will be provided for free as well as a some prize giveaways. Let me know if anyone needs additional info, it will be a fun day!

Great to hear!

It was a lot of work, but worth it. Final count was 153 kids plus who knows how many parents. So the advertising is definitely the hard part. We gave out 300 fliers at Gamefair, put ads in 4 newspapers, hung flyers in 25 or more businesses, had a mention on Minnesota Bound, WCCO, and KFAN, word of mouth and a mailing to another 300 kids. But I fully feel we didnt reach that many. So any ideas (that dont cost an arm and a leg) would be appreciated. As for the offer of help....oh, could we use it. Basically 3 of us planned and organized the whole thing. We had 12 volunteers and could have used 25. There were lines 10 deep on the shotgun shooting stations (2) and the .22 shooting stations (3) all day. So if you would help, you could really help us out. Thankfully Rapids Archery Club, 4H Shooting Sports, the US Fish and Wildlife Service, MN Trappers Assoc, Wildlife Science Center, Douglas County Pheasants Forever, and MDHA all helped out a ton.
